    Swimplatform didn't make it on my boat either here's how it ended up looking. Don't hate me I know it not a mariah but it was a nice 266 crownline it ended up on.
    For those who followed early in the post you know I was thinking of a all tubular style but after talking with Oregondune it changed up loved his idea better. ImageUploadedByTapatalk HD1369708648.981206.jpg ImageUploadedByTapatalk HD1369708682.251561.jpg seadek was going to go on top of the UHMW sheet.
    After we had it that way the customers wife didn't like the tube showing so I covered it in fiberglass and add wings to flow with the hull and let us use the Ubolts tie downs as side anchoring point to the platform too. It was color matched( he picked the color) to the boat before he decided to have me fully detail it wet sanding and buffing got back the original cream color so he's going bring it back this winter to reshoot it.
